
Ken Mehlman
Partner, Global Head of Public Policy & Affairs and Co-Head of KKR Global Impact Business Operations, Global Impact New York
Ken Mehlman (New York) joined KKR in 2008 and is a Partner, Global Head of Public Policy & Affairs and Co-Head of Global Impact. He works to enhance the firm’s work by leveraging geopolitical, public policy and sustainability trends. KKR Global Impact is the firm’s private market investing platform focused on businesses that promote commercial solutions to global challenges associated with economic development, environmental management, next generation energy, agricultural and food production, responsible land use and education & learning. He is currently a member of the Board of Directors of FGS Global, Graduation Alliance and Lightcast. Before KKR, Mr. Mehlman spent a dozen years in national politics and government service, including as 62nd Chairman of the Republican National Committee, Campaign Manager of President Bush's 2004 re-election campaign, the only Republican presidential campaign in 36 years to win a majority of the popular vote, and White House Political Director in 2002, the only time the incumbent President’s party gained seats in a first midterm election in 90 years. Mr. Mehlman, who currently lives in New York City, graduated with a B.A. from Franklin & Marshall College, and holds a J.D. from Harvard Law School. He is a trustee of Mt. Sinai Hospital of New York, Franklin & Marshall College, Teach for America, and Sponsors of Educational Opportunity (SEO). Mr. Mehlman was active in the successful effort for marriage equality and is currently co-Chair of The Nantucket Project and a member of the Council on Foreign Relations.
